How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Chadbourn?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Chadbourn Studio Apartments | $1,524 | $1,524 | $1,524 |
Chadbourn 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,552 | $600 | $3,843 |
Chadbourn 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,814 | $700 | $4,690 |
Chadbourn 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,037 | $800 | $4,877 |
Chadbourn 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,857 | $875 | $2,345 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Chadbourn
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Chadbourn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Chadbourn ranges from $600 to $3,843 with an average monthly rent of $1,552.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Chadbourn c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Chadbourn range from $700 to $4,690.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,814.
How expensive are Chadbourn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 35 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Chadbourn on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$800 to $4,877 - averaging $2,037 for the location.
